Robyn Ingle-Möller from Lory Park Animal and Owl Sanctuary received special award from the JCP module

Posted on April 07, 2019

Robyn Ingle-Möller from Lory Park Animal and Owl Sanctuary was specially acknowledged by the Community-based Project Module (JCP) of the Faculty of Engineering, Built Environment and Information Technology for being involved in the module for the past 12 years. She mentored more than 1201 students and 310 groups, first at the National Zoological Gardens of South Africa. Later at Bester Birds and Animal Zoo Park and for the past two and half years at Lory Park Animal and Owl Sanctuary. She mentors between 20 and 25 groups per year. Her dedication towards the JCP-module reflects in the high-quality projects delivered by the students as well as their positive feedback on their community experiences.

Only with the support and assistance of dedicated community partners, like Robynn, can the University of Pretoria be able to deliver quality community projects to our communities. The community partner plays a crucial role in the development of social awareness and social responsibility of our students.
